USGS Loc. 16916 - Beaver Branch [Clayton Fm] (Paleocene of the United States)

Where: Crenshaw County, Alabama (31.7° N, 86.3° W: paleocoordinates 34.5° N, 66.4° W)

• coordinate based on nearby landmark

• outcrop-level geographic resolution

When: Clayton Formation (Midway Group), Danian (66.0 - 61.6 Ma)

• LITHOSTRATIGRAPHY: Not stated in text; assumed to be from Clayton Fm, on the basis of other local collections. AGE: Paleocene in test; assumed to be Danian on the basis of age of other local collections. STRATIGRAPHIC REPORTED: From unknown position in local section.

• bed-level stratigraphic resolution

Environment/lithology: coastal; lithology not reported

Size class: macrofossils

Collected by MacNeil; reposited in the USNM

Collection methods: surface (float), surface (in situ),

• COLLECTOR: F.S. MacNeil. REPOSITORY: USNM (formerly USGS).

Primary reference: C. W. Cooke. 1959. Cenozoic echinoids of eastern United States. United States Geological Survey Professional Papers 321:1-106 [L. Villier/L. Villier/M. Hopkins]more details

Purpose of describing collection: taxonomic analysis
